Subject: net: splice: avoid high order page splitting
From: Eric Dumazet <[email protected]>
[ Upstream commit 82bda6195615891181115f579a480aa5001ce7e9 ]
splice() can handle pages of any order, but network code tries hard to
split them in PAGE_SIZE units. Not quite successfully anyway, as
__splice_segment() assumed poff < PAGE_SIZE. This is true for
the skb->data part, not necessarily for the fragments.
This patch removes this logic to give the pages as they are in the skb.
